首页
/ Arcane 项目使用教程

Arcane 项目使用教程

2025-04-17 01:46:56作者:邓越浪Henry

1. 项目的目录结构及介绍

Arcane 项目采用 Swift 编写,其目录结构如下:

Arcane/
├── .gitignore
├── Arcane.xcodeproj
├── Sources/
│   └── Arcane/
├── Tests/
├── .swiftpm/
│   └── package.xcworkspace
├── Arcane.podspec
├── CONTRIBUTING.md
├── LICENSE.md
├── Package.swift
└── README.md
  • .gitignore:用于指定 Git 忽略的文件和目录。
  • Arcane.xcodeproj:Xcode 项目文件,用于在 Xcode 中打开和管理项目。
  • Sources/:存放项目源代码的目录。
    • Arcane/:项目的核心代码目录。
  • Tests/:存放测试代码的目录。
  • .swiftpm/:Swift Package Manager 的相关文件。
    • package.xcworkspace:用于在 Xcode 中打开 Swift 包管理器项目。
  • Arcane.podspec:用于将项目作为 CocoaPods 库进行发布的配置文件。
  • CONTRIBUTING.md:贡献指南,介绍如何为项目贡献代码。
  • LICENSE.md:项目使用的许可证文件。
  • Package.swift:Swift 包管理器的配置文件,用于定义项目的依赖和目标。
  • README.md:项目说明文件,介绍项目的功能和用法。

2. 项目的启动文件介绍

项目的启动文件为 Arcane.xcodeproj,这是一个 Xcode 项目文件。你可以使用 Xcode 打开这个文件,然后编译和运行项目。

3. 项目的配置文件介绍

项目的配置文件主要有两个,分别是 .gitignorePackage.swift

  • .gitignore 文件用于指定 Git 忽略的文件和目录。这个文件通常包含一些编译生成的文件、系统文件以及私人配置文件等。例如,可能包括 DerivedData 目录、node_modules 目录以及 *.DS_Store 文件等。

  • Package.swift 文件是 Swift 包管理器的配置文件。在这个文件中,你可以定义项目的名称、版本、依赖项以及其他相关信息。以下是一个简单的 Package.swift 示例:

.package(url: "https://github.com/onmyway133/Arcane.git", from: "3.0.0"),

上述代码定义了一个依赖项,它指向了 Arcane 项目的 GitHub 仓库,并指定了版本为 3.0.0。在项目的 Package.swift 文件中配置好依赖后,Swift 包管理器会自动下载并构建这些依赖项。

登录后查看全文
热门项目推荐